goatdan
12-11-2004, 10:11 PM
I can't stand the control in Halo for some reason (all modern FPS control, honestly), and I didn't much care for it. I own the Xbox game, and I gave up playing after about an hour.

That having been said, I can completely see why people love the game. The production quality is extremely high. The enemies are interesting, and the storyline (from what I've seen / read) is great. And the multiplayer is very strategic.

I haven't played H2 yet, but I figure I'll end up thinking the same thing.

I just wanted to note this now:

Doom 3 was declared as many people as being overrated, although I adored it. I thought that the storyline was excellent (well... most of it), the scare tactics were horrifying and the gameplay was really solid. That having been said, I can also completely see why people didn't like it:

It wasn't the "classic" Doom style of run fast and shoot everything. Instead, you had all this other stuff to worry about too, and the pacing, especially with changing the flashlight was the opposite of what most people expected from the follow up to such a fast-paced game.

I think that depending on what you were looking for, either game can be over or underrated.

Spottedkitty
12-13-2004, 11:47 AM
I have to say that while I'm really enjoying Halo2 and it's online play (well, mostly) it's just not the Halo I knew and loved. Not that that's a bad thing but there are a few minor issues that are spoling it for me overall.

Don't get me wrong, I'm a *huge* Halo fan, it was what brought me back to gaming after a long drought, however I think H2 has really become "just another" FPS. There's still the storyline (which along with the books and community is really quite interesting) and the online play is really quite good but...just...well...there's something missing.

The thing that caught me in the original was the whole "30 seconds" philosophy. The hook that got me was the fact there were so many little moments that stood out when I was playing it. The Elites flanking you when you go to ground, anytime you ran into the Grunts (Ahh, the Grunts!), the music and numerous other things. I just didn't get the same feeling from Halo2. The set pices felt more of a slog and less fun, especially on the higher difficulty settings. ***spoiler*** There was a section late in the game where you're on the High Charity that if I'd played through one more time I was gonna break the TV. That never happened in the original no matter how many times I had to re-play a section ***end spoiler***

The "popups" (where textures and even whole models just appear) in the cut-scenes and stuff really put me off as well. I'd rather have the loading screens, thanks. Just makes the whole shebang look unprofessional. Nice idea, but it didn't work in practice.

And, lastly, the online play. Oh the online play. I'll start off by saying that I'm having a blast in online stuff. So far the ranking system has given me some good games. There still remains the fact you cannot have a public un-ranked custom game. I could live with this fact if the reason given for not putting one in wasn't so, well, arrogant. The basic reason given for not putting on in is the fact they had the nice new spangly ranking/matchmaking system and were afraid noone would use it and therefor decided not to give people the choice. If I'd try to say to some of my customers they couldn't have something because I didn't want to give it to them I'd have zero customers in a very short space of time. I'm also dissapointed that *none* of the H2 reviews out there ever picked up on this.

So, all in all, great game and one I'll be playing for ages yet (I still have PoP2 on my shelf wiating to be played) but not really the game I was expecting when it comes down to it.
